You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

反卷积层的形状意外

在使用反卷积层时,有时候会遇到形状意外的问题。这通常是由于输入和输出的尺寸不匹配导致的。以下是几种解决方法的示例代码:

方法一:调整卷积核和步长

import tensorflow as tf

# 定义输入
input_shape = [None, 28, 28, 32]  # 输入形状为 [批量大小, 高度, 宽度, 通道数]
inputs = tf.placeholder(tf.float32, shape=input_shape)

# 定义反卷积层
output_shape = [None, 56, 56, 16]  # 输出形状为 [批量大小, 高度, 宽度, 通道数]
deconv = tf.layers.conv2d_transpose(inputs, filters=16, kernel_size=3, strides=2, padding='same', output_shape=output_shape)

# 打印输出形状
print(deconv.shape)

方法二:使用tf.image.resize_images()调整尺寸

import tensorflow as tf

# 定义输入
input_shape = [None, 28, 28, 32]  # 输入形状为 [批量大小, 高度, 宽度, 通道数]
inputs = tf.placeholder(tf.float32, shape=input_shape)

# 定义反卷积层
output_shape = [None, 56, 56, 16]  # 输出形状为 [批量大小, 高度, 宽度, 通道数]
deconv = tf.layers.conv2d_transpose(inputs, filters=16, kernel_size=3, strides=2, padding='same')

# 调整尺寸
deconv_resized = tf.image.resize_images(deconv, output_shape[1:3])

# 打印输出形状
print(deconv_resized.shape)

方法三:使用tf.keras.layers.UpSampling2D()调整尺寸

import tensorflow as tf

# 定义输入
input_shape = [None, 28, 28, 32]  # 输入形状为 [批量大小, 高度, 宽度, 通道数]
inputs = tf.placeholder(tf.float32, shape=input_shape)

# 定义反卷积层
output_shape = [None, 56, 56, 16]  # 输出形状为 [批量大小, 高度, 宽度, 通道数]
deconv = tf.layers.conv2d_transpose(inputs, filters=16, kernel_size=3, strides=1, padding='same')

# 调整尺寸
deconv_resized = tf.keras.layers.UpSampling2D(size=(2, 2))(deconv)

# 打印输出形状
print(deconv_resized.shape)

以上代码示例中,我们通过调整卷积核的大小、步长、使用tf.image.resize_images()tf.keras.layers.UpSampling2D()来解决反卷积层形状意外的问题。这些方法可以根据具体情况选择使用。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

2022年终总结-两年Androider的技术成长之路|社区征文

不出意外年终还是差哈哈,年终奖估计只能拿两个月工资(大佬们勿喷,我的base很低很低)>我并不后悔,年轻嘛,要把时间花在提升自己身上,不要因小失大上半年的重构完成之后,下半年都只是一些业务上的小修小改并没有太... 很好奇也很憧憬大学生活是什么样子的,师叔满足了我的这个好奇心。由于我们差不多的是同龄人,所以生活上的一些问题我们也会一起互相交流,这个年龄的我们都很迷茫,但是也都充满理想和希望## 总结**后半年语雀知识...

CVer从0入门NLP——GPT是如何一步步诞生的|社区征文

我们可不可以通过数值来反应他们之间的相似度呢,当然可以,一种常见的计算相似度的方法是余弦相似度`cosine_similarity`,结果如下:![pic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u... 其实这个公式和卷积神经网络的公式是很像的,只不过RNN这里有两个输入而已。还有一点和大家说一下,上图公式中含有转置,实现起来转置来转置去的会很绕,上面的公式其实和下面是一样的【上下两个$x_t$维度其实变了】:...

TensorFlow白屏监控应用实战

它的作用是对卷积层输出的空间数据进行池化(采样),采用的池化策略是最大值池化。它将输入的图像划分为若干个矩形区域,对每个子区域输出最大值。效果见下图:![picture.image](https://p6-volc-community-sign.byt... 但是校验数据的损失值却开始反方向上升,这是发生了过拟合现象,考试是王者,实战是青铜,那怎么样解决过拟合问题呢?为数据集添加更多的训练数据,在 TensorFlow 官网中有介绍,我们对图片进行旋转、剪切、添加噪声从而...

让欺诈风险无处遁形的计算机视觉| 社区征文

出不穷的欺诈手段伴随信息技术的快速发展,黑产欺诈和电信诈骗等日益猖獗,且呈现高发、多发态势,急需提升银行对交易的风险识别和防控能力,实现跨渠道、全天候、实时的交易监控。按攻击方式不同,欺诈风险可分4类... 精准识别能力是视觉反欺诈能力的核心,决定了实际应用效果。我们的识别模型主要应用了基于MKLDNN加速策略的分类网络模型,在多个任务上改善了轻量型模型的性能,整体网络使用串联结构,同时使用了深度可分离卷积作...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

反卷积层的形状意外-优选内容

2022年终总结-两年Androider的技术成长之路|社区征文
不出意外年终还是差哈哈,年终奖估计只能拿两个月工资(大佬们勿喷,我的base很低很低)>我并不后悔,年轻嘛,要把时间花在提升自己身上,不要因小失大上半年的重构完成之后,下半年都只是一些业务上的小修小改并没有太... 很好奇也很憧憬大学生活是什么样子的,师叔满足了我的这个好奇心。由于我们差不多的是同龄人,所以生活上的一些问题我们也会一起互相交流,这个年龄的我们都很迷茫,但是也都充满理想和希望## 总结**后半年语雀知识...
CVer从0入门NLP——GPT是如何一步步诞生的|社区征文
我们可不可以通过数值来反应他们之间的相似度呢,当然可以,一种常见的计算相似度的方法是余弦相似度`cosine_similarity`,结果如下:![pic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u... 其实这个公式和卷积神经网络的公式是很像的,只不过RNN这里有两个输入而已。还有一点和大家说一下,上图公式中含有转置,实现起来转置来转置去的会很绕,上面的公式其实和下面是一样的【上下两个$x_t$维度其实变了】:...
TensorFlow白屏监控应用实战
它的作用是对卷积层输出的空间数据进行池化(采样),采用的池化策略是最大值池化。它将输入的图像划分为若干个矩形区域,对每个子区域输出最大值。效果见下图:![picture.image](https://p6-volc-community-sign.byt... 但是校验数据的损失值却开始反方向上升,这是发生了过拟合现象,考试是王者,实战是青铜,那怎么样解决过拟合问题呢?为数据集添加更多的训练数据,在 TensorFlow 官网中有介绍,我们对图片进行旋转、剪切、添加噪声从而...
让欺诈风险无处遁形的计算机视觉| 社区征文
出不穷的欺诈手段伴随信息技术的快速发展,黑产欺诈和电信诈骗等日益猖獗,且呈现高发、多发态势,急需提升银行对交易的风险识别和防控能力,实现跨渠道、全天候、实时的交易监控。按攻击方式不同,欺诈风险可分4类... 精准识别能力是视觉反欺诈能力的核心,决定了实际应用效果。我们的识别模型主要应用了基于MKLDNN加速策略的分类网络模型,在多个任务上改善了轻量型模型的性能,整体网络使用串联结构,同时使用了深度可分离卷积作...

反卷积层的形状意外-相关内容

读取日志服务 TLS 数据写入云搜索服务 ESCloud

删除保护功能用于防止实例被意外删除,因此在该选项启用期间,您无法删除实例。 计费类型 选择实例的计费类型,支持按量计费和包年包月。关于计费的详细信息,请参见计费概述。 在确认订单页面,查看实例配置详情,阅... format 用来反序列化 Kafka 消息体(value)时使用的格式。此处设置为 json。 properties.enable.idempotence 是否启用 Kafka Client 的事务消息能力,此处设置为 false,以关闭事务消息。 properties.security....

火山引擎短信服务协议(抖音电商)

如您违反安全规则或本协议中任一项承诺与保证的,包括但不限于在本协议签订时不具备开展业务所需的全部资质许可、履行相关手续,或在本协议有效期内丧失全部或部分资质许可的,火山引擎有权暂停提供服务,并要求您在限... 不可抗力以及意外事件引起的。 (19) 非我们的原因造成的服务不可用或服务不达标的情况。 (20) 属于适用法律法规、协议、规则或火山引擎门户单独发布的规则、说明等中所述的我们可以免责、免除赔偿责任等的情况...

火山引擎开发者社区第四届有奖征文大赛获奖作品公布

[基于图卷积神经网络和卷积注意力模块的癫痫检测](https://developer.volcengine.com/articles/7317917892278747175) by [大大怪与小小怪](https://developer.volcengine.com/user/3266000014813699)1. [大数据技术年度总结 |主赛道](https://developer.volcengine.com/articles/7318303259507032091) by [用户9425120174949](https://developer.volcengine.com/user/2878972407325002)1. [2023 总结对AI的总结和展望|社区...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

社区征文|2022风景

> 人生最自然、健康的状态是:优秀的时候享受,糟糕的时候接受。有精力的时候努力,没精力的时候休息。 ------《反脆弱》今天是2022年最后一天上班了,泡上一杯鸭屎香,是时候给它画个句号!以往,年终总结只存在于工... 如果有意外,那就是公司的问题。遗憾,工作上的遗憾还是**没有遇到好的产品经理**。这么多年来,我很多工作都是没有产品或设计参与,大部分功能是我自主研发、包括交互、用户体验,所以我跟人对用户体验是有很大的追求...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询